1 pkg (19-1/4 oz) yellow cake mix
1-1/4 cups 1% buttermilk
4 egg whites
1 egg
1 pkg (8oz) reduced fat cream cheese-cubed
1 cup cold 2% milk
1 pkg (1 oz) sugar freee instant vanilla pudding mix
2 cans (one 20 oz, one 8 oz) unsweetened crushed pineapple-drained
1 carton (8oz) frozen fat free Cool Whip-thawed
1/2 cup flake coconut-toasted
In a mixing bowl, beat the dry cake mix, buttermilk, egg whites and egg on low speed until moistened. Beat on high for 2 minutes. Pour into 13x9 inch baking pan that has been sprayed with nonstick spray. Bake at 350 degrees for 25-30 minutes or till toothpick comes out clean. Cool on wire rack. In another mixing bowl, beat cream cheese until fluffy, gradually beat in milk. Gradually add pudding mix, spread over cake . Spoon pineapple over pudding mixture, top with Cool Whip and sprinkle with coconut. Store in refridgerator.
One piece~
Calories 221
Fat 5 grms
Carbs 38 grms
